Writer/Director Walter Hermosa Jr was born and raised in Asunción, Paraguay. He has been a fan of film since the age of 3 and started directing short films at a very young age. When he was 17, his horror short film "The Girl From Across The Street" was shown in Paraguayan television which gained him a lot of attention. With the attention, his other short films were also shown in television. Later that year, alongside his good friend Pedro Noah Espinola, Walt, who was 18 at the time, co-wrote and co-directed a feature film called "Saber Crecer". The film opened to good critical reception and also gave Paraguay a whole new wave of young and up-incoming filmmakers. Later on, Walt moved to LA in pursue of a expanding his film career, directing numerous shorts and working on many others.
